Research Abstract

The purpose of this study was to estimate several indications concerning the obesity correlated with visceral fat accumulation. And correlationship between daily physical-activity and visceral fat accumulation were examined in-relation with 13-adrenergic receptor genotypes. The subjects were 73 community-dwelling females (mean age±SD, 51±6 ). They worn the pedometer (Lifecorder) on the waist and performed daily life for about 2 months, before measuring BMI, % fat, abdominal subcutaneous and visceral fat by MRI, waist circumstance length, plasma leptin concentration. Highly correlation coefficients were shown between visceral fat area (by MRI) and BMI, % fat, waist circumstance length and plasma leptin concentration. According the average daily steps, 4 groups were classified into (1)less than 7000steps, (2)7000-10000steps, (3)10000-13000steps, and (4)more than 13000steps. BMI, % fat, abdominal subcutaneous and visceral fat by MRI, waist circumstance length, plasma leptin concentration were extremely low in the group of more than 13000steps.β-adrenergic receptor genotypes were classified by 64Trp or 64Arg into 3types (TT, TA and AA). TT types were shown in 60 persons, and TA in 6 persons, and AA in only 1 person. There was no direct correlationship between genotype and obesity indications.
